The ".7z" format is used by modders to bundle the APK (executable), OBB (data files), and sometimes texture packs or save files with unlimited gold.

  • Install the APK: Tap the APK file and install it. Do not open the game yet.
  • Copy OBB Data: Using ZArchiver, copy the com.fantasynpc.game folder to Android/obb/ on your internal storage.
  • Launch: Open the game. If you see a black screen, your OBB is in the wrong location (check for double folders).
